Abstract This paper introduces a study on optimum determination of exchanged grinding wheel diameter when external grinding of stainless steel. In this study, the influences of grinding process parameters including the initial grinding wheel diameter, the total dressing depth, the radial grinding wheel wear per dress and the wheel life on the exchanged grinding wheel diameter were investigated. Also, the effect of cost parameters including the grinding wheel cost and the machine tool hourly rate were investigated. To estimate the influence of these parameters on the optimum exchanged grinding wheel diameter, a simulation experiment was designed and it was performed by a computer program. Based on the results of the experiment, a formula for calculation of the optimum exchanged diameter was introduced
